Writer from Sweden searching for relatives

 


To The Eagle:

Hello, My name is Annica Eriksson and I am from Sweden. It seems that parts of my family went to America as a lot of other Swedes did. I found a letter from one of them that lived in Cathlamet. She died in 1989 (17/8) and her name was Helga Benson Head.

She came to America in 1912 with her mother Berna (Bernhardina) and her grandfather. Her father had probably left Sweden earlier I think. I found a letter that Helga had sent in 1968 to my father and mother in Gothenburg. She mentioned a son and his three daughters. They lived in Portland, Ore., she said. But she never wrote any names or addresses.

So I just ask you if you could help me finding them. By names or addresses or anything. I remember Helga in 1968. I was only eight years old but I thought it was very exiting. Visiting family from USA! Helga B. Head and her husband, John Alden Head, are buried at Greenwood Cemetery. She died in 1989 and John Alden on Nov 28, 1952. John Alden’s parents were Eliza Filer Head 1870-1966 and William Wilkie Head 1866-1965. They are also buried at Greenwood. Helga’s Swedish parents are also buried at Greenwood. John and Berna Benson. My question is if there is some way for me to find the names and maybe addresses to Helga’s son and his children? They lived in Portland in 1968. Some information have I found but not more than I write in this letter. It should be very nice if there is a chance to get in contact with these relatives. I know that this is a strange thing to send a email about. By the way; the last address on this letter from 1968 is: Mrs John A. Head, Cathlamet, Washington 98612, USA. It would be so nice to find more relatives in USA! Best,
